Sandor Preisinger (born 11 December 1973 in Zalaegerszeg) is a Hungarian football player, and most recently the manager of Zalaegerszegi TE.
Sandor was a member of the Hungary squad that reached the 1996 Summer Olympics finals in Atlanta, USA.
He played 186 matches in the Hungarian First Division and scored a total of 64 goals.
In the season 1994/95, Sandor Preisinger was the top scorer of the Hungarian league with 21 goals while playing for Zalaegerszegi TE.
He started his international career with Hungary on 5 June 1999 against Romania in a EURO 2000 qualifier match.
